The Siemens SIRIUS 3RV2021-1KA20 is a motor protection circuit breaker designed for the main current circuit of induction motors. It provides overload and short-circuit protection up to 100 kA at 400 V AC, with Trip Class 10 release characteristics — meaning it trips within 10 seconds at 7.2× the thermal setting, matching the startup profile of standard squirrel-cage motors. Phase failure detection is built in, so a lost phase on the line side will trip the breaker before single-phasing damages the motor winding. Ground fault detection is not included — if that's required, pair this with a separate ground-fault relay or specify the 3RV2021-4CA25 variant that includes it. Spring-loaded terminals accept 2× (1 to 10 mm²) solid or stranded conductors, which covers most motor feeder sizes up to the 12.5 A continuous rating at 480/600 V. The 45 mm width and 97 mm depth fit standard 35 mm DIN rail per DIN EN 60715, with screw and snap-on mounting in any position.
Breaking capacity and motor sizing
The 3RV2021-1KA20 delivers 100 kA at 240 V AC and 400 V AC, 42 kA at 500 V AC, and 4 kA at 690 V AC. That 100 kA at 400 V is the headline number — it means this breaker can safely interrupt a fault current up to 100,000 A on a 400 V line without welding contacts or rupturing the case, which covers most industrial distribution panels with transformer ratings up to 2.5 MVA. Motor horsepower equivalents: 2 hp at 230 V, 3 hp at 220/230 V, 8 hp at 460/480 V, 10 hp at 575/600 V. The 12.5 A continuous rating at 480 V and 600 V aligns with NEMA size 1 motor starters for those horsepower ranges.

Environmental and mounting
Operating temperature range is -20 to +60 °C; storage and transport range is -50 to +80 °C. The 50 mm upwards and downwards clearance and 30 mm side clearance are required for arc flash venting and heat dissipation — no forward or backward clearance needed. Mount in any position on 35 mm DIN rail per DIN EN 60715. The screw and snap-on fastening method lets you screw it down for vibration resistance or snap it on for quick replacement — useful when the panel is in a high-vibration area like a conveyor line or compressor skid.
